Scholastic (SCHL)

Trailing 12-Month GAAP Operating Margin: 3%

Creator of the legendary Scholastic Book Fair, Scholastic (NASDAQ: SCHL) is an international company specializing in children's publishing, education, and media services.

Why Do We Pass on SCHL?

  1. Lackluster 4% annual revenue growth over the last five years indicates the company is losing ground to competitors
  2. Projected 25.1 percentage point decline in its free cash flow margin next year reflects the company’s plans to increase its investments to defend its market position
  3. Waning returns on capital from an already weak starting point displays the inefficacy of management’s past and current investment decisions

Leonardo DRS (DRS)

Trailing 12-Month GAAP Operating Margin: 10.5%

Developing submarine detection systems for the U.S. Navy, Leonardo DRS (NASDAQ: DRS) is a provider of defense systems, electronics, and military support services.

Why Are We Cautious About DRS?

  1. Annual revenue growth of 5.6% over the last five years was below our standards for the industrials sector
  2. Sales pipeline suggests its future revenue growth won’t meet our standards as its backlog averaged 6.8% declines over the past two years
  3. Eroding returns on capital suggest its historical profit centers are aging

Hubbell (HUBB)

Trailing 12-Month GAAP Operating Margin: 20.2%

A respected player in the electrical segment, Hubbell (NYSE: HUBB) manufactures electronic products for the construction, industrial, utility, and telecommunications markets.

Why Do We Love HUBB?

  1. Solid 9.8% annual revenue growth over the last five years indicates its offerings solve complex business issues
  2. Share repurchases over the last five years enabled its annual earnings per share growth of 18.9% to outpace its revenue gains
  3. Free cash flow margin grew by 5.8 percentage points over the last five years, giving the company more chips to play with
